Log:
Fix LSR compile time.
This is a simple fix that brings the compilation time from 5min to 5s
on a specific real-world example. It's a large chain of computation in
a crypto routine (always a problem for SCEV). A unit test is not
feasible and there would be no way to check it. The fix is just basic
good practice for dealing with SCEVs, there's no risk of regression.
Patch by Daniel Reynaud!

@@ -3117,10 +3117,15 @@ void
LSRInstance::CollectLoopInvariantFixupsAndFormulae() {
SmallVector<const SCEV *, 8> Worklist(RegUses.begin(), RegUses.end());
SmallPtrSet<const SCEV *, 8> Inserted;
+ SmallPtrSet<const SCEV *, 32> Done;
while (!Worklist.empty()) {
const SCEV *S = Worklist.pop_back_val();
+ // Don't process the same SCEV twice
+ if (!Done.insert(S))
+ continue;
+
if (const SCEVNAryExpr *N = dyn_cast<SCEVNAryExpr>(S))
Worklist.append(N->op_begin(), N->op_end());
